Kath & Kim - American Version

American Version

Due to the success that Kath & Kim has achieved internationally, it was remade for US audiences by NBC. In this remake, actress Molly Shannon has taken the role of Kath Day, and Selma Blair the role of Kim. NBC chose Jason Ensler to direct Molly Shannon's Kath & Kim. Michelle Nader developed the series for American television, which premiered in the United States as part of the Fall schedule of 2008. The series started to shoot in California in July 2008. NBC debuted the US adaptation on 9 October 2008, while Seven started screening it to Australian viewers on 12 October 2008. After airing only two episodes, Seven dropped the sitcom from their lineup due to poor ratings, only to bring it back several weeks later as a late-night schedule stuffer. On the other hand, NBC, after averaging roughly around 5 to 7 million viewers per week, was rewarded with a full season order in October 2008. On Tuesday, 19 May 2009, NBC announced that there would not be a second season of "Kath & Kim".
